Explore the timeless debate surrounding fairness in wealth distribution with John Augustine Ryan's "Distributive Justice: The Right and Wrong of Our Present Distribution of Wealth." This thought-provoking work delves into the ethical and moral dimensions of income distribution, examining the principles of social justice that underpin a just society.

Ryan, a prominent voice in social ethics, meticulously analyzes the existing systems of wealth allocation and challenges readers to consider the inherent rights and wrongs within them. Focusing on the core tenets of distributive justice, this book provides a framework for understanding the complexities of economic inequality.

A key contribution to the field of social sciences, "Distributive Justice" offers invaluable insights for anyone seeking a deeper understanding of the moral aspects related to economic systems. This volume is a crucial resource for students, scholars, and general readers interested in economics, ethics, poverty, and the ongoing quest for a more equitable distribution of wealth.
